Nano Hash - криптовалюты, майнинг, программирование

передать объект Java в модальный режим начальной загрузки

я пытаюсь передать объект Java для отображения в моем модальном режиме начальной загрузки... В каждой строке моего datatable у меня есть этот код:

<td><a href="#" class="btn btn-warning edit"  data-toggle="modal" data-whatever="${u}" data-target="#exampleModal">

Где ${u} - мой объект для отображения... Я попробовал этот код jquery:

<script type="text/javascript">
    $('#exampleModal').on('show.bs.modal', function (event) {
   var button = $(event.relatedTarget); // Button that triggered the modal
  var recipient = button.data('whatever'); // Extract info from data-* attributes
 var modal = $(this);
modal.find('.modal-title').text('New message to ' + recipient);
modal.find('.modal-body input').val(recipient);

});

Он показывает что-то вроде этого модальное изображение

Я не знаю, есть ли способ отображать каждое свойство объекта в каждом поле... я много гуглил, но безуспешно... У кого-нибудь есть идеи? Спасибо.


  • просто чтобы сказать, что я никогда раньше не использовал jquery с java :)!!! 26.04.2018
  • я посетил эту ссылку jsfiddle.net/sudarpochong/nxL8jezp, которая очень интересна, но действительно хочу продолжить работу с объектом 26.04.2018

Ответы:


1

Похоже, вы присваиваете объект data.whatever="${u}", но поскольку объекты не существуют в HTML так, как они существуют, например, в Java, ваш объект превращается в строку, когда страница отправляется клиенту. Я предполагаю, что вы намереваетесь сделать так, чтобы каждый из входов имел разные поля для одного и того же объекта. Если это так, то вы хотели бы иметь data.whatever = "${u.fieldName}", и вы можете иметь другое имя поля для каждого из ваших входов в вашем модальном режиме.

29.04.2018
  • Привет, Джон, я попытался отправить каждое поле, как вы объясняете, выполнив data-id = data-firstname = data-lastname =, и это сработало нормально .... Большое спасибо 30.04.2018
  • Новые материалы

    Кластеризация: более глубокий взгляд
    Кластеризация — это метод обучения без учителя, в котором мы пытаемся найти группы в наборе данных на основе некоторых известных или неизвестных свойств, которые могут существовать. Независимо от..

    Как написать эффективное резюме
    Предложения по дизайну и макету, чтобы представить себя профессионально Вам не позвонили на собеседование после того, как вы несколько раз подали заявку на работу своей мечты? У вас может..

    Частный метод Python: улучшение инкапсуляции и безопасности
    Введение Python — универсальный и мощный язык программирования, известный своей простотой и удобством использования. Одной из ключевых особенностей, отличающих Python от других языков, является..

    Как я автоматизирую тестирование с помощью Jest
    Шутка для победы, когда дело касается автоматизации тестирования Одной очень важной частью разработки программного обеспечения является автоматизация тестирования, поскольку она создает..

    Работа с векторными символическими архитектурами, часть 4 (искусственный интеллект)
    Hyperseed: неконтролируемое обучение с векторными символическими архитектурами (arXiv) Автор: Евгений Осипов , Сачин Кахавала , Диланта Хапутантри , Тимал Кемпития , Дасвин Де Сильва ,..

    Понимание расстояния Вассерштейна: мощная метрика в машинном обучении
    В обширной области машинного обучения часто возникает необходимость сравнивать и измерять различия между распределениями вероятностей. Традиционные метрики расстояния, такие как евклидово..

    Обеспечение масштабируемости LLM: облачный анализ с помощью AWS Fargate и Copilot
    В динамичной области искусственного интеллекта все большее распространение получают модели больших языков (LLM). Они жизненно важны для различных приложений, таких как интеллектуальные..